Common Barley Uses:
- Livestock Feed: High-energy grain for cattle, hogs, poultry, and horses
- Malt Production: Specific malt barley varieties for brewing and distilling industries
- Forage/Silage: Cut green for high-quality livestock feed
- Cover Crop: Soil improvement and erosion control
- Cash Crop: Market grain for feed or malt markets

Planting Guidelines:
- Seeding Rate: 90-125 lbs per acre (2.5-3.5 bushels/acre) depending on variety and conditions
- Best Planting Time: Early spring as soon as soil can be worked (April-May in most BC Interior regions)
- Soil Requirements: Well-drained soils; tolerates wide pH range (6.0-8.0)
- Depth: Plant 1-2 inches deep; deeper in dry conditions
- Row Spacing: 6-9 inches for optimal yield
- Fertility: Requires adequate nitrogen (60-100 lbs N/acre) and phosphorus
- Maturity: 90-110 days depending on variety
Agronomic Benefits:
- Early Maturity: Shorter growing season than wheat allows earlier harvest and field turnover
- Drought Tolerance: Better drought tolerance than many other cereals, ideal for dryland production
- Rotation Crop: Excellent break crop in rotation to manage disease and improve soil health
- Versatile: Can be used for grain, forage, or cover crop depending on market conditions
- Lower Input Costs: Generally requires less nitrogen than wheat
